FreeOnes Announces Open Registration for Its 'Model Store'

THE NETHERLANDS — FreeOnes.com announced today open registration to its Model Stores.

The platform was launched earlier this year as a new revenue stream for models and their representatives where store owners can upload their photo sets and videos to earn revenue from FreeOnes’s traffic.

“Up until now, both models and webmasters had to be invited to use the Model Stores,” FreeOnes team member Petra, said. “We are excited to now offer open registration to the public so that anyone who thinks that they qualify for a store can sign up and start making money.”

The company noted that the opportunity is open to established models and porn stars, amateur girls, cam girls, and producers/webmasters who represent a model.

Participants can sign up for a store even if there is no current “babe” section under the model's name. As long as the model has a first and last stage name and some quality links, they are eligible to be include in the “babe” section.

FreeOnes said that the platform provides a new, easy revenue stream for webmasters with idle content.

“Just upload the photo sets and videos, schedule when you want them to come out, assign a price, and then let us worry about hosting and billing. Also remember that we've been around since 1998 and have a massive following that reaches millions of people each month,” Petra, said.
